Transaction

5eea8fd366ee93e6c15cd30424a703675451dc2381dcf9423e7ca4571f914d60

Summary

In Block308108
TimeFri, 11 Aug 2023 15:30:15 UTC
Total Input786.36604817 Nebula
Total Output841.36604817 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
658367 Confirmations841.36604817 Nebula
Raw Transaction